Slide up the black battery cover located on the interior side of the lock and remove it. Then, unsnap the battery connector (terminals with a short wire) to remove the battery tray. Replace the batteries inside the tray. Ensure the batteries are facing the door when reinstalling the battery tray.

Encode lock allows you to lock and unlock your Schlage lock …If it's not enabled, the lock won't beep or light up. To enable the alarm, simply press and hold down on the inside Schlage button for around five seconds. Release the button when it flashes. If you want to disable the alarm in the future, you'll hold down the button until there are two flashes.

Wait for 3 orange lights and 3 beeps. Press the Schlage button; the keypad should light up. Press the number “7” on the keypad; you should see 1 green light and hear 1 long beep. After completing these steps, the turn lock feature should be enabled, allowing you to lock your door from the outside.

Misaligned Schlage keypad locks. If the Schlage keypad lock has become misaligned, it may not be able to be unlocked even with a perfectly good key. This can happen for a variety of reasons, including wear and tear, physical damage, or even changes in temperature or humidity. You might be using wrong battery type or size, the compartment is not cleaned eno...2. Jammed lock. A jammed lock is a common cause of a Schlage lock not working. A jammed lock occurs when dirt, debris, or foreign objects become lodged in the lock mechanism, preventing it from functioning properly. You'll get one beep and one blink of the green checkmark.What is Vacation Mode on a Schlage Lock? The Vacation Mode feature (when enabled) temporarily deactivates all User Codes in your Schlage Lock. In this mode, even though a valid User Code is entered, your lock won’t unlock until the Vacation Mode is canceled. Enabling Vacation Mode on Your Schlage Lock.
